响应式图片的优化策略

文旅笔记家 2019-09-21 ⋅ 16 阅读

随着移动设备的普及和网页设计的发展,响应式设计已成为设计领域的一项重要技术。而在响应式设计中,图片的优化是至关重要的一环。本文将介绍一些优化策略,以确保在任何屏幕大小和设备上都能提供最佳的用户体验。

1. 选择适当的图片格式

根据不同的场景选择适当的图片格式是优化的关键。常见的图片格式有JPEG、PNG和GIF。JPEG适用于彩色照片,具有较好的压缩效果;PNG适用于图标和透明背景图片,但文件大小相对较大;GIF适用于动画效果。根据图片的内容和需求选择合适的格式能够有效地减少图片的文件大小,提高加载速度。

2. 压缩图片

无论是使用何种格式的图片,压缩都是优化图片的基本步骤。通过使用图片编辑工具或在线压缩工具,可以减少图片的文件大小,从而提高加载速度。注意,压缩过度可能会导致图片质量下降,因此需要权衡压缩比和图像清晰度之间的关系。

3. 使用适当的分辨率

不同屏幕大小和分辨率的设备需要加载不同分辨率的图片。通过使用srcset属性和sizes属性来指定不同分辨率的图片,浏览器将根据设备的屏幕大小选择合适的图片进行加载,避免不必要的资源浪费。

4. 懒加载或预加载

大量的图片可能会影响页面的加载速度。因此,可以通过采用懒加载或预加载的技术来优化图片的加载。懒加载是指仅加载可见区域图片,当用户滚动页面时再加载其他图片;预加载是指提前加载页面上将要展示的图片,以提高用户感知的加载速度。通过这两种技术,可以减少不必要的请求和提高页面的加载性能。

5. 响应式图片工具

使用响应式图片工具可以简化优化图片的过程。这些工具可以根据不同设备的需求自动调整图片的大小、格式和分辨率。其中一些工具还可以根据网络状况和设备配置进行动态加载和优化。一些常用的响应式图片工具有CloudinaryImgIX等。

优化响应式图片是提高网页性能和用户体验的重要一环。通过选择合适的图片格式、压缩图片、使用适当的分辨率、懒加载或预加载以及使用响应式图片工具,可以有效地减少图片的文件大小和加载时间,提高页面的加载速度和用户体验。希望本文介绍的优化策略对于网页设计和开发有所帮助。


全部评论: 0

    我有话说: